Prenons un exemple : vous souhaitez lancer un JAR avec la commande javaw (rappel = la commande javaw fait la même chose que la commande java mais sans afficher de console).
Il faut créer un fichier contenant ci :
Attention, la commande invoquée (ici javaw) DOIT ÊTRE DANS VOTRE PATH !
[Nemo Action]
Name=Lancer le JAR
Comment=Execute un fichier JAR/WAR avec javaw
Exec=javaw -jar %F
Icon-Name=bug-buddy
Selection=Any
Extensions=jar;war;
Où mettre ce fichier ?
Pour qu'il soit accessible à tous les utilisateurs (il vous faudra les droits root) :
## Placez votre fichier ici :
/usr/share/nemo/actions/
Pour qu'il ne soit accessible qu'à vous-même (pas d'élévation de privilèges) :
## Placez votre fichier ici :
$HOME/.local/share/nemo/actions/
Un dernière contrainte ?
Oui, votre fichier DOIT AVOIR L'EXTENSION :
Présentation sur le devops bizops
Plein de template de présentation en HTML5 / CSS3, gratuites et libres !!!
Quelques templates à se mettre sous le coude pour la boîte :
- https://html5up.net/arcana (le basic)
- https://html5up.net/telephasic (celui avec un template utile pour les sociétés)
- https://html5up.net/helios (comme le précédent mais différent)
- https://html5up.net/hyperspace (le minimalist pour avoir un site avec de la gueule en deux trois pages très très vite)
Edit : Je suis retombée accidentellement sur le site de HTML5 UP et je dois dire que je suis vraiment convaincue par les différents thèmes. Je pense qu'il doit être possible de créer une sorte de petit business à partir des modèles, après il faut voir avec la licence créative common.
Tout est dans le titre.
Comment s'auto-héberger. Un tuto assez complet.
Pour Roudoudoutte.
Un wrapper pour utiliser Git à travers PHP. J'avais exactement besoin de ça, merci tout plein :D
Pour Animal... Ça se rapproche...
Sous le coude
Un peu tout dans ce post. Ce qui m'intéresse c'est comment réécrire l'historique de commits avec Git.
Pour les débutants sur Git, voici un petit rappel.
1) Git ne vous permet pas de commiter tout de suite. Vous devez d'abord ajouter les fichiers modifiés dans un panier temporaire de choses à commiter (ce panier est appelé "stage"). Et c'est uniquement ce qui se trouve dans ce panier qui sera commité avec la commande "git commit".
2) Pour ajouter au panier vous faites simplement :
- git add
- git add . (ça c'est pour ajouter tous les fichiers modifiés d'un seul coup)
3) Pour commiter c'est simple :
- git commit
- git commit -m "Message du commit"
4) À l'instar de Mercurial, Git dissocie le commit (i.e je versionne mon travail pour moi en local) du push (je transmet mon travail à mes copains). Pour propager son travail il faut faire :
- git push origin
5) De la même manière, Git dissocie le commit et le push de la récupération du travail des copains. Pour récupérer le travail des autres il faut faire :
- git pull origin
Procotols de sécurité TLS, SSL, RSA et AES
Je commence de lister un ensemble de commandes Git utiles.
Comment récupérer la liste de tous les auteurs ayant contribué à un répo :
git log --format='%aN' | sort -u
Comment commiter à une autre date que la date du jour ?
git commit --date="Wed Feb 16 14:00 2011 +0100"
==> Le format est obligatoirement celui fournit dans l'exemple.
Comment afficher le contenu d'un fichier à une date précise :
git show ${ID_COMMIT}:Test.txt
==> À noter que ${ID_COMMIT} peut être un tag, un hash ou une branche.
19 commandes Git à retenir.
Récupération de la loi via légifrance.
Animal, ceci est une forme d'appel pour te rappeler quels sont les enjeux de se bouger le cul...
Protéger sa vie privée